A lot of posts here ask about a way of playing from computer/phone to Sonos, or using it as PA. One solution, is using "SWYH" from computer, which is working - but has 2 seconds latency. I found an Android application, that can send with 0.2s latency. Download "AirAudio". By default it has the regular 2 seconds latency. Go to "Settings", "SONOS", "Audio format" -> WAV. Now you can change the "Audio delay". With trial and error, I reduced it to 0.2s and it's working great. In other environments it might be slightly other value. Now, the questions is - how do they do it? And can we repeat that success in a computer program?
